INTE 6601 - History, Theory, and Method of Interpreting


Explores representative topics, movements, and texts in the history, theory, and method of interpreting, traces the development of the discipline, and introduces the practice of interpreting in three different modes: sight translation, consecutive, and simultaneous.

Credit Hours: (3)
Repeatability: May be repeated for credit with change of topic.
